Description of intervention(s) / exposure
GPs receive further training regarding asthma consultations by participating in 3 hours of education (a 2 hour interactive educational session and a 1 hour academic detaling session at their practice location)
Intervention code [1] 2052 0
Behaviour
Comparator / control treatment
Control group GPs were waitlisted to receive the educational intervention after completion of the study.

Summary
Brief summary
The aim of this research was to conduct a randomised placebo controlled trial of an asthma education intervention for GPs, addressing the needs of older people with asthma, to improve the outcomes in this group
